We have the old style Curtis Cab where the doors swing out. The cart is 10 years old and I had the door assemblies (pistons and rods) replaced this year. Works great and very tight again, cost about $400 but compared to prices for the new Curtis sliding doors, I'll take it! That is the question you must ask, do you want convenience in summer for rain and winter for cold. We love our closed cab and would not buy an open one. Many of our friends bought open carts only to re-purchase a closed cart. It is not hot in the summer! But, it is a lot warmer in the winter. My two cents.
